Regent Close, Fleet house prices

In Regent Close, Fleet, the median price a home actually changed hands for is £174,500. Over the past decade prices are +2% in cash — but −27% once inflation is stripped out.

Regent Close, Fleet house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in Regent Close, Fleet?

Half of homes sold in Regent Close, Fleet went for more than £174,500 and half for less, across 52 sales.

What is the price range of homes sold in Regent Close, Fleet?

Recorded sales in Regent Close, Fleet range from £42,250 to £672,500.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in Regent Close, Fleet risen?

Over the past decade prices in Regent Close, Fleet are +2% in cash terms but −27%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in Regent Close, Fleet?

In Regent Close, Fleet the median price is £3,175 per square metre, from 32 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Regent Close, Fleet was 20 March 2026.
